PHILADELPHIA (CBS) – Authorities are investigating what caused a driver to crash into the side of an apartment complex in Northeast Philadelphia early Monday morning.
The incident happened at about 2:30 a.m. at the Petoni Apartments in the 13000 block of Bustleton Avenue in the city’s Somerton section.
Authorities say the unidentified man, who lives in the complex, drove his car into the main building of the complex that borders Bustleton Avenue. The man then backed up, drove to the rear of the building where he parked his car and went inside his apartment.
Police are investigating whether alcohol or drugs played a role in the crash. So far, no charges have been filed.
There were no reports of any injuries.
The incident remains under police investigation.
